Jewelbombs are strange enemies. They are jet black and encrusted with pink gems, and have a grasping on a long arm. It carries a Bomb-Rock in its claw, which is infused with sticky black liquid. When provoked, it will make the Bomb-Rock explode, shooting this liquid everywhere. The blobs of slime stick everywhere and Pikmin that get stuck cannot be freed unless whistled out. The Bomb-Rock is regenerated shortly after, even when the Jewelbomb is dead.
Pikmin X: Deep Freeze
Jewelbombs return in Pikmin X: Deep Freeze with some changes. It now only has two legs plus a grasping tail that it uses to roll bomb-rocks towards Pikmin like bowling balls, which are able to knock Pikmin over as they move. It can also intercept bomb-rocks placed or thrown by Pikmin to send them back at them as well. Jewelbomb bomb-rocks do not splatter sticky slime in this game and they do not regenerate while the creature is dead, only while it is attacking.
